This is why I’m not particularly fond of remakes. Reboots or reimaginings are fine, but remakes (especially in today’s era of filmmaking) tend to rehash older movies with a bigger budget, modern movie stars and excessive use of CGI — mostly because producers have the power to do so. There are exceptions, of course (Cape Fear (1991), Scarface (1983)), that don’t contribute to the bad reputation of the “remake”, but it seems like it’s becoming more and more common in Hollywood to tell the same story over and over rather than work on original ideas.
